    Quote Originally Posted by Andre View Post
    I have never been quite sure why a leader or tippet guage is needed. Surely all the information is on the spool.
    You cut a leader shorter (remember our little conversation the other day?) and oops you dunno the diameter anymore a gauge works great in this instance.
